¿Cuánto cuesta alquilar un apartamento en Fort Lauderdale?
| Dormitorios | Precio Promedio | Más barato | Más caro |
|---|---|---|---|
| Apartamentos Estudio en Fort Lauderdale | $2,189 | $999 | $4,950 |
| Apartamentos 1 Dormitorios en Fort Lauderdale | $2,567 | $1,050 | $7,520 |
| Apartamentos 2 Dormitorios en Fort Lauderdale | $3,298 | $1,325 | $10,000+ |
| Apartamentos 3 Dormitorios en Fort Lauderdale | $4,490 | $1,617 | $10,000+ |
| Apartamentos 4 Dormitorios en Fort Lauderdale | $8,615 | $1,000 | $10,000+ |
| Apartamentos 5 Dormitorios en Fort Lauderdale | $16,149 | $10,000 | $10,000+ |
